Is Your Website Content Doing Its Job?

We all know that first impressions matter — and when it comes to your website, your content is the one making that first impression.

Your website isn’t just a digital business card — it’s your brand’s voice, your 24/7 salesperson, and your biggest marketing tool. And if it’s not pulling its weight, it might be time for a content makeover.

At Net Designs, we believe content should work for your business — grabbing attention, building trust, and moving people to act. So if your site feels a little… tired? Flat? Confusing? Let’s change that.

Here are 5 reasons it might be time to refresh your website content — and how to do it right:


1. It’s Not Captivating (Yawn…)

Your content should grab people by the eyeballs and keep them scrolling. Today’s visitors don’t just want information — they want a story. They want you — your personality, your style, your message — all wrapped in a voice that makes them feel something. Boring, cookie-cutter copy? Not on our watch.


2. It’s Not Speaking to the Right Crowd

If your visitors are clicking away in seconds, it’s a sign your message isn’t landing. Great content starts by understanding your audience — their problems, their questions, and their goals. Speak their language, and they’ll stick around (and come back for more).


3. It’s Not Leading Anywhere

Your content needs a mission: is it helping people contact you, buy from you, donate, or book a service? If you’re throwing info at the screen with no strategy behind it, you’re wasting valuable real estate. Clear, structured, and compelling content should guide visitors toward action — one click at a time.


4. It’s Not Making Them Curious

You don’t just want visitors — you want fans. People who browse a few pages, read what you have to say, and actually remember you. If your content is just “fine,” it’s forgettable. Engaging, fresh content makes people curious, keeps them clicking, and sets you apart from your competitors.


5. It’s Not Creating Engagement

Your content should do more than inform — it should invite participation. That might mean a form fill, a purchase, a share, or a phone call. Whatever your version of “conversion” is, strong calls to action, persuasive copy, and a consistent voice across your site are what make it happen.
